Today is Tuesday, Nov. 13, 2012. On this day in 1982, the Vietnam Veterans Memorial is dedicated in Washington to honor those who served in the Vietnam War.

Famous birthdays include Robert Louis Stevenson – 1850; Whoopi Goldberg – 1955; Jimmy Kimmel – 1967; Gerard Butler – 1969.
